监控linux的CPU内存进程工具sar

监控linux的CPU内存进程工具sar 下载地址

http://pagesperso-orange.fr/sebastien.godard/download.html 

 

1 安装
   tar zxvf  xxx.tar.gz

  ./configure

   make

   make install

 

使用
 pidstat 2 5 
 //每隔2秒,显示5次,所有活动进程的CPU使用情况
 pidstat -p 3132 2 5 
 //每隔2秒,显示5次,PID为3132的进程的CPU使用情况显示
 pidstat -p 3132 2 5 -r
 //每隔2秒,显示5次,PID为3132的进程的内存使用情况显示

  

查看CPU使用情况

sar 2 5
//每隔2秒,显示5次,CPU使用的情况

 

  %usrCPU处在用户模式下的时间百分比。 
  %sysCPU处在系统模式下的时间百分比。 
  %wioCPU等待输入输出完成时间的百分比。 
  %idleCPU空闲时间百分比。

猜你喜欢

转载自onlyor.iteye.com/blog/1697822